What Are Free Boiler Installations?

Free boiler installations are part of government-supported schemes that aim to help homeowners replace their old, inefficient boilers with new, energy-efficient ones. These schemes are designed to tackle fuel poverty, improve living conditions, and reduce the environmental impact of domestic heating.

The most well-known initiative is the ECO4 scheme, which is the fourth phase of the Energy Company Obligation program. Under this scheme, energy companies fund the installation of new boilers for eligible households. Homeowners or tenants who qualify can receive a brand-new boiler at no cost. This allows families with limited budgets to benefit from modern heating technology without worrying about the financial burden.

Why Boilers Are Central to Energy Efficiency

Boilers are at the heart of most homes in the UK. They provide hot water and central heating, which are both essential for daily life. However, older boilers are often inefficient. Some older models only use around 60% of the fuel they consume, wasting the rest as heat.

Modern boilers, on the other hand, can achieve efficiencies of over 90%. This means they use almost all the fuel for heating purposes and waste very little. As a result, modern boilers save money on energy bills and help reduce the demand for fossil fuels. By upgrading through free boiler installations, households can make a big difference to their energy use.

How Homeowners Can Qualify for Free Boiler Installations

Eligibility for free boiler installations depends on several factors. The government aims to target households that need support the most. Typically, applicants must meet certain criteria, such as receiving specific benefits, living in a low-income household, or having an old and inefficient boiler.

The process usually begins with a quick eligibility check. Once approved, a certified installer assesses the property and recommends the best type of boiler. After this, the installation is carried out at no cost to the homeowner. The entire process is designed to be simple and stress-free, making it accessible for those who need it most.

The Role of the ECO4 Scheme

The ECO4 scheme is central to free boiler installations across the UK. It focuses on helping low-income households, reducing fuel poverty, and cutting carbon emissions. Energy suppliers are required by law to fund improvements such as boiler replacements, insulation, and renewable heating measures.

Under ECO4, homeowners and tenants can benefit from upgraded heating systems without paying for them. The scheme is designed to create long-term change by ensuring homes are warmer, more energy-efficient, and more environmentally friendly. By promoting greener homes, ECO4 also supports the UK’s broader environmental goals.
